A very rare small, portable fortepiano

The Orphica Piano library offers an very special little piano: Invented by Carl Leopold Röllig, the small portable piano type was exclusively built by piano maker Joseph Donal at the end of the 18th century.

Produced for merely about 15 years, the Orphica remains one of the rarest pianos today – worldwide, only 30 instruments have been preserved at the very most. Inventor Röllig was reminded of the “Lyre of Orpheus”, so he chose the name accordingly for what happens to be a predecessor of today’s portable keyboard.

The instrument featured in this sample library was built around 1798 and offers a slinky, charming and lively piano tone unlike any regular piano sound – thanks to its small size featuring three octaves, it has a different main focus: Twinkle-toed, yet present with chocolate-like mids and with the typical piano-like grace, it can be great for any piano track asking for a fresh, unconsumed sound.
